package channelserver
|
||||
|
||||
import (
|
||||
"io/ioutil"
|
||||
"path/filepath"
|
||||
|
||||
"erupe-ce/common/byteframe"
|
||||
"erupe-ce/network/mhfpacket"
|
||||
"go.uber.org/zap"
|
||||
)
|
||||
|
||||
func handleMsgMhfSaveRengokuData(s *Session, p mhfpacket.MHFPacket) {
|
||||
// saved every floor on road, holds values such as floors progressed, points etc.
|
||||
// can be safely handled by the client
|
||||
pkt := p.(*mhfpacket.MsgMhfSaveRengokuData)
|
||||
_, err := s.server.db.Exec("UPDATE characters SET rengokudata=$1 WHERE id=$2", pkt.RawDataPayload, s.charID)
|
||||
if err != nil {
|
||||
s.logger.Fatal("Failed to update rengokudata savedata in db", zap.Error(err))
|
||||
}
|
||||
|
||||
doAckSimpleSucceed(s, pkt.AckHandle, []byte{0x00, 0x00, 0x00, 0x00})
|
||||
}
